Metal roofing cost by panel type.

Installed prices for Collinsville, adjusted for local labor. Roof size, pitch, and trim complexity move the number within each range.

  • Corrugated / exposed fastener
    Entry point for metal roofing
    $7,800 – $19,500
  • Standing seam steel
    Concealed fasteners, premium panel
    $14,500 – $39,000
  • Aluminum
    Corrosion-resistant — fits coastal climates
    $12,500 – $32,000
  • Stone-coated steel
    Shingle or tile look in metal
    $13,500 – $29,000
  • Copper & zinc
    Specialty architectural metals
    $24,500 – $58,500+
  • Tear-off & disposal
    Removing the old roof
    $950 – $2,900
  • Permits & inspection
    Varies by municipality
    $250 – $950

* Adjusted for Collinsville; an on-site measure refines panel and trim counts.

Before you sign: the quote checklist

  •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Collinsville.
  •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
  •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
  •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Cost factors

Why Metal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Collinsville

Several factors unique to Collinsville affect the cost of a metal roof replacement. The local climate, with its frequent windstorms and hail, often requires higher-grade materials that can withstand impact. The age and style of your home also matter—older homes in the Uptown area may have complex roof geometries that increase labor time. Illinois state building codes set minimum standards for wind resistance and snow loads, which can influence material choices. Labor rates in the Metro East region reflect the local cost of living and demand for skilled contractors. Finally, disposal of old roofing materials and permit fees from the city's permitting office add to the total. Each of these variables means that no two replacement projects cost the same.

Field notes

Common Reasons Collinsville Roofs Need Replacement

  1. Hail Damage

    Collinsville experiences hailstorms several times a year, especially in spring. Hail can bruise metal panels or cause dents that compromise the roof's appearance and protective coating, leading to replacement.

  2. Wind Uplift

    Strong straight-line winds from thunderstorms can lift metal panels, especially if fasteners are aged or improperly installed. Repeated wind events can cause panels to loosen or detach entirely.

  3. UV Degradation

    The intense summer sun in Illinois accelerates UV breakdown of paint coatings on metal roofs. Over time, fading and chalking occur, and the underlying metal may corrode if not replaced.

  4. Ice Dams

    Winter snow and freeze-thaw cycles can create ice dams along eaves. While metal roofs shed snow better than asphalt, improper insulation or ventilation can still lead to ice buildup and water infiltration.

  5. Algae and Moss Growth

    Humid summers in Collinsville promote algae and moss growth on roof surfaces. On metal roofs, this can trap moisture against the metal, accelerating corrosion and reducing the roof's lifespan.

The process

What to Expect During a Metal Roof Replacement in Collinsville

In Illinois, roofing contractors must hold a state license and comply with local building codes. The process begins with a thorough inspection of your existing roof and structure. After measuring and ordering materials, the crew will remove the old roof, inspect the decking, and make any necessary repairs. The metal panels are then installed according to manufacturer specifications, with attention to flashing and ventilation. A final inspection by your local building department ensures the work meets code. The entire project typically takes several days to a week, depending on the size and complexity of your roof.

How do I choose a roofing contractor for a metal roof in Collinsville?

Look for contractors licensed in Illinois with experience installing metal roofs. Ask for references from local projects and check online reviews. Verify they carry liability insurance and workers' compensation. A good contractor will provide a detailed written estimate and explain the warranty on both materials and labor. Avoid contractors who pressure you to sign immediately or ask for full payment upfront.

What are the Illinois licensing requirements for roofing contractors?

Illinois requires roofing contractors to hold a state license through the Department of Financial and Professional Regulation. They must pass a background check and provide proof of insurance. Additionally, local municipalities like Collinsville may have their own business license requirements. Always verify a contractor's license before hiring.

When is the ideal time to replace a metal roof in Collinsville?

The ideal time is late spring through early fall, when weather is mild and dry. This allows for proper installation and curing of sealants. However, metal roofs can be installed in cooler months as long as temperatures are above the manufacturer's recommended minimum (usually around 40°F). Avoid scheduling during peak storm season if possible.

Do I need a permit for a metal roof replacement in Collinsville?

Yes, most roof replacements in Collinsville require a building permit from the city's permitting office. Your contractor should handle the permit application as part of their service. The permit ensures the work meets local building codes for wind resistance and fire safety. Failure to obtain a permit can result in fines and issues when selling your home.
